探索前端开发工具(深入了解前端开发工具的分类和特点)

游客 28 2024-10-05

在当今互联网时代,前端开发工具成为了每个前端开发者必备的利器。它们可以帮助我们更高效地编写代码、调试、测试以及优化性能。本文将围绕前端开发工具的类型和功能展开详细解析,带你进入一个全新的前端开发世界。

代码编辑器的选择与技巧

1.选择合适的代码编辑器,提升编码效率

选择一个适合自己编码风格的编辑器是前端开发中的第一步。介绍了常见代码编辑器(如VisualStudioCode、SublimeText等)的特点和常用功能,以及如何根据个人需求进行选择。

2.代码编辑器的常用插件与配置

通过安装合适的插件和进行适当的配置,可以进一步提升代码编辑器的功能和便利性。介绍了常用插件(如Emmet、Prettier等)和配置技巧,使开发者能够更高效地编写代码。

调试工具的妙用与技巧

3.浏览器开发者工具的功能与使用

详细介绍了浏览器开发者工具的功能,包括元素检查、网络监控、性能分析等,以及如何利用这些工具进行调试和性能优化。

4.移动端调试工具的选择与应用

移动端开发中,常常需要使用特定的调试工具来模拟移动设备环境和调试移动端页面。介绍了常用的移动端调试工具(如ChromeDevTools、SafariWebInspector)及其应用技巧。

构建工具的高效使用与实践

5.了解构建工具的基本原理与流程

介绍了构建工具的基本原理,包括代码编译、文件压缩、模块化打包等流程,帮助开发者更好地理解构建工具在前端开发中的作用。

6.常用构建工具的比较与选择

比较了常见的构建工具(如Webpack、Gulp、Grunt等)的特点和适用场景,帮助开发者选择合适的构建工具来优化项目的构建过程。

性能优化工具的探索与实践

7.页面性能分析工具的应用与技巧

介绍了常见的页面性能分析工具(如Lighthouse、PageSpeedInsights)的使用方法和优化技巧,帮助开发者提升页面加载速度和性能表现。

8.图片压缩与优化工具的选择与使用

详细介绍了常用的图片压缩与优化工具(如TinyPNG、ImageOptim等)的特点和使用方法,帮助开发者减少图片资源的大小和加载时间。

团队协作工具的应用与分享

9.版本控制工具的选择与实践

介绍了常用的版本控制工具(如Git、SVN)的特点和基本使用方法,以及如何在团队协作中更好地利用版本控制工具进行代码管理。

10.在线协作与项目管理工具的运用

介绍了常见的在线协作与项目管理工具(如GitHub、Trello等)的特点和应用场景,帮助开发团队更好地组织和管理项目。

辅助工具的简化与智能化

11.CSS预处理器与后处理器的应用技巧

介绍了常见的CSS预处理器(如Sass、Less)和后处理器(如PostCSS)的特点和使用方法,以及如何利用它们简化和优化CSS代码。

12.自动化测试工具的选择与实践

介绍了常用的自动化测试工具(如Jest、Mocha)的特点和使用方法,帮助开发者建立健全的测试体系,提高代码质量和可靠性。

新兴工具与前端开发趋势

13.WebAssembly的应用前景与技术实践

介绍了WebAssembly的基本原理和应用前景,以及如何利用WebAssembly来提升前端应用的性能和功能。

14.前端框架与组件库的选择与比较

比较了常见的前端框架(如React、Angular、Vue.js)和组件库的特点和适用场景,帮助开发者选择合适的框架和组件库来提升开发效率和用户体验。

通过本文的介绍,我们可以看到前端开发工具的种类繁多,每一种工具都有自己独特的功能和优势。在实际开发中,根据项目需求和个人偏好选择合适的工具,将会极大地提升开发效率和代码质量。希望本文能为广大前端开发者提供一个全面了解前端开发工具的指南。

探索前端开发工具的类型与应用

在现代软件开发中,前端开发工具扮演着至关重要的角色。无论是简化开发流程、提高开发效率,还是改善用户体验,前端开发工具都起到了关键作用。本文将介绍前端开发工具的主要类型,并探讨它们在实际项目中的应用情况。

1.编辑器与集成开发环境(IDE):提供代码编辑、自动补全、语法检查等功能,帮助开发人员快速编写和调试代码。

编辑器和IDE是前端开发中不可或缺的工具,通过提供丰富的编辑功能和开发环境,大大提高了开发效率。

2.包管理工具:帮助开发人员管理项目所使用的依赖库和模块,自动处理版本冲突和依赖关系。

包管理工具可以帮助开发人员更好地管理项目依赖,并提供快速、稳定的构建过程。

3.自动化构建工具:自动化处理常见的构建任务,如编译、压缩、打包等,提高开发效率和部署质量。

自动化构建工具能够自动执行繁琐的构建任务,减轻开发人员的工作负担,提高整个项目的开发效率。

4.调试工具:用于定位和解决前端应用程序中的错误和问题,提供调试信息和工具。

调试工具是前端开发过程中必备的工具,通过定位和解决问题,帮助开发人员提高代码质量和用户体验。

5.前端框架与库:提供丰富的前端组件和功能模块,加速开发过程,提高代码质量。

前端框架和库可以极大地简化开发过程,提供高效的组件和功能模块,帮助开发人员快速构建复杂的前端应用程序。

6.性能优化工具:用于分析、监测和优化前端应用程序的性能,提升用户体验。

性能优化工具可以帮助开发人员了解和解决前端应用程序的性能问题,提升用户体验并降低资源消耗。

7.测试工具:用于自动化测试前端应用程序,确保其在不同环境和浏览器中的正常运行。

测试工具能够自动化执行测试用例,并提供准确的测试结果,帮助开发人员保证应用程序的质量和可靠性。

8.版本控制工具:用于管理和协作开发团队的代码版本,提供分支管理、合并等功能。

版本控制工具可以有效地管理和协作开发团队的代码,提供灵活的分支管理和合并功能,保证代码的一致性和可维护性。

9.文档生成工具:用于自动生成项目文档,包括接口文档、使用手册等。

文档生成工具可以帮助开发人员自动化生成文档,减少手动编写文档的工作量,提高文档的质量和更新效率。

10.可视化工具:提供可视化编辑和设计界面,帮助开发人员快速搭建用户界面。

可视化工具通过提供直观的界面编辑和设计功能,帮助开发人员快速搭建用户界面,减少代码编写的工作量。

11.浏览器开发工具:集成在浏览器中的调试和分析工具,用于开发和测试前端应用程序。

浏览器开发工具提供了丰富的调试和分析功能,帮助开发人员快速定位和解决前端应用程序中的问题。

12.代码质量工具:用于检查和改善代码的规范性、可维护性和性能。

代码质量工具可以帮助开发人员检查和改善代码的质量,确保代码符合规范、易于维护和高效运行。

13.前端安全工具:用于检测和防止前端应用程序的安全漏洞和攻击。

前端安全工具可以帮助开发人员检测和防止前端应用程序的安全漏洞和攻击,保护用户数据的安全和隐私。

14.前端模板引擎:用于生成动态内容的模板引擎,提供灵活的数据绑定和渲染功能。

前端模板引擎可以帮助开发人员生成动态内容,提供灵活的数据绑定和渲染功能,减少手动操作的工作量。

15.移动端开发工具:专门针对移动端应用程序开发的工具集,提供特定的功能和调试支持。

移动端开发工具提供了针对移动端应用程序开发的特定功能和调试支持,帮助开发人员优化移动端应用的用户体验。

前端开发工具涵盖了多个不同类型,包括编辑器与IDE、自动化构建工具、调试工具、前端框架与库等。这些工具在实际项目中发挥着重要作用,提高了开发效率、优化了用户体验、保证了代码质量。熟悉并合理应用这些工具,将有助于前端开发人员提升技术水平和项目管理能力。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 3561739510@qq.com 举报,一经查实,本站将立刻删除。

本文地址:https://www.0793u.com/article-3342-1.html

上一篇:探索最好的无限制访问的浏览器——自由浏览器(突破封锁)
下一篇:探索重装系统的三种方法(帮助您了解重装系统的多种选择)
相关文章
微信二维码